Audio signal processing plays an important role in various applications such as speech recognition, music information retrieval, and speech synthesis. Among them, Mel spectrogram is a commonly used frequency domain feature representation method, which describes the sensitivity of the human auditory system to frequency. In this article, we will conduct performance tests on three commonly used audio processing libraries - audioflux, torchaudio, librosa, and essentia - to evaluate their efficiency in computing Mel spectrograms.
